Abstract

The invention discloses a nano modified polyethylene terephthalate major diameter monofilament and a production method thereof. The diameter of monofilament is 0.08-2mm, and titanium dioxide in polyester is nano titanium dioxide. The invention has high strength and good property, tensile strength of monofilament is more than 8CN/dtex, and elongation at break is 20-30%.

Description

Nano modification PET major diameter monofilament and production method thereof
Technical field:
The present invention relates to a kind of nano modification PET major diameter monofilament.
Background technology:
Existing PET monofilament, thinner, and intensity is low, and performance is undesirable.
Summary of the invention:
The object of the present invention is to provide a kind of intensity is big, performance is good nano modification PET major diameter monofilament and production method thereof.
Technical solution of the present invention is:
A kind of nano modification PET major diameter monofilament, it is characterized in that: filament diameter is 0.08~2mm, titanium dioxide is Nano titanium dioxide in the polyester.
The production method of a kind of nano modification PET (PET) major diameter monofilament comprises spinning, cooling, stretching, HEAT SETTING step, and it is characterized in that: spinning temperature is 275~290 ℃; Cooling is adopted 40~60 ℃ of water-cooleds but; Stretch and adopt two roads to stretch, draw ratio is 5~6 times, and the first road draft temperature is 95 ℃; The second road draft temperature is 135 ℃, and heat setting temperature is 220 ℃.
Intensity of the present invention is big, performance good, and the TENSILE STRENGTH of monofilament is greater than 8CN/dtex, and elongation at break is 20%~30%.
